Nested Tables का استعمال کیوں نہ کرنا

Nested Tables توهان جي ويب صفعن کي سست ڪيو

ويب صفحن کي تيز ڪرڻ لاء ضروري آهي، پر اينسٽ ٽيسٽ کي عمل کي سست ڪري سگهن ٿا. ڪنهن به کي توهان کي ٻڌائي نه ڏيو ته وڌيڪ ماڻهن براڊ بيڊ يا تيز رفتار انٽرنيٽ استعمال ڪريو، تنهنڪري توهان کي پريشان ٿيڻ جي ضرورت ناهي ته توهان جا صفحا ڪيترا تيز ٿين ٿا. ويب تي مواد جي مقدار سان، هڪ پيج يا سائيٽ جيڪو دير سان لوڊ ٿئي ٿو ان کان گهٽ گهڻن سياحن جو جيڪو جلدي لوڊ ڪري ٿو. اسپيڊ تمام اھم آھي.

ھڪڙو اينز ٿيل ٽيبل ڇا آھي؟

ھڪ اينز ٿيل ٽيبل ھڪڙو HTML ٽيبل آھي جنھن جي اندر ھڪ ٻئي جي ٽيبل آھي. مثال طور:

<ٽيبل>

ڪالم 1
ڪالمن 2
ڪالمن 3


کالم 1

<ٽيبل>

ناھر ٿيل ٽيبل ڪالمن 1
ناھر ٿيل ٽيبل ڪالمن 2



کالم 3


کالم 1
کالم 2
کالم 3

Nested Tables کي وڌيڪ تيزيء سان ڊائونلوڊ ڪريو

ھڪڙي صفحي جي ويب پيج تي ھڪڙي جدول جي صفحي کي وڌيڪ سست ڪرڻ (سبب جي ڪري) ڊائون لوڊ نٿو ڪري سگھي. پر توهان هڪ ٽيبل ڪنهن ٻئي ميز جي اندر رکي، اهو برائوزر لاء وڌيڪ پيچيده ٿي ويندو آهي، تنهن ڪري صفحي جو وڌيڪ سست وڌيڪ. ۽ هڪ ٻئي اندر اندر وڌيڪ ٽيبل آهن، اهي پنو لوڊ لوڊ ڪندي.

جڏهن توهان هڪ صفحو جدولن سان ٺاهي، ذهن ۾ رکون ٿا ته ميبل اندر وڌيڪ ٽيبل، سست پنو لوڊ ڪندي. عام طور تي، جڏهن هڪ صفحو بوٽ، برائوزر HTML جي چوٽي تي شروع ٿئي ٿو ۽ اهو ترتيب سان ڏنل صفحي تي لوڊ ڪري ٿو. تنهن هوندي، ناست ٿيل جدولن سان، انهي ميز کي ختم ڪرڻ کان پهرين اهو سڄو شيون ڏيکاري ٿو.

ليٽنگ لاء ٽيبل

توھان پنھنجي ويب صفحن ۾ ترتيب لاء جدولن کي استعمال نه ڪرڻ گھرجي. اهي تقريبن هميشه لاء گهربل آهن ته توهان اينسٽ ٽيبل استعمال ڪندا آهيو، تنهنڪري هڪ ٽيبل جي ترتيب ويب صفحي سي ايس ۾ مهيا ڪيل ساڳئي ڊزائن کان وڌيڪ سست وڌندي ويندي.

انهي سان، جيڪڏهن توهان صحيح XHTML لکڻ جي ڪوشش ڪري رهيا آهيو، جدولن کي ترتيب لاء استعمال نه ڪرڻ گهرجي. ٽيبلبل ڊيٽا (جهڙوڪ اسپريڊ شيٽ) جي لاء، ترتيب لاء نه آهن. انهي جي بدران، توهان کي سيٽنگ استعمال ڪرڻ لاء سي ايس ايس ڊيزائن کي وڌيڪ جلدي رونما ڪرڻ لاء ۽ توهان کي درست XHTML برقرار رکڻ ۾ مدد ڪرڻ گهرجي.

تيزيء سان ڊزائين لوڊ ڪندي

جيڪڏهن توهان هڪ ميز جي ڪيترن ئي قطارن سان ٺهيل آهيو، اهو گهڻو ڪري وڌيڪ جلدي لوڊ ڪري سگهو ٿا جيڪڏهن توهان الڳ جدول جي هر قطار کي لکندا آهيو. مثال طور، توهان هن کي ٽيبل تي لکي سگهو ٿا:

<ٽيبل انداز = "چوڑائي: 100٪؛">

چوٽي قطار


ڇڏي ويو ڪالمن
صحيح کالم

پر جيڪڏهن توهان ساڳئي ٽيبل تي ٻه ٽيبل طور لکيا، ته اهو وڌيڪ جلدي لوڊ ٿي سگهندو، ڇاڪاڻ ته برائوزر پهريون ڀيرو ڏيکاري رٿا ۽ پوء ٻئي ميز کي سڄي ميز کي ڏيارڻ جي ڀيٽ ۾. چيڪ ڪرڻ يقيني بڻائڻ آهي ته هر ميز جي هڪ جيتري چوٽي ۽ ٻين طرزن وانگر (جهڙوڊنگ، گنجائش، ۽ سرحدون).

<ٽيبل انداز = "چوڑائي: 100٪؛">

چوٽي قطار


<ٽيبل انداز = "چوڑائي: 100٪؛">

ڇڏي ويو ڪالمن
صحيح کالم

ھڪڙي جدول ۾ اينسٽ ڪيل ٽيبلز تبديل ڪندي

توهان شايد محسوس ڪيو ته اهو سڀ ڪجهه سٺو ڄاڻ آهي، پر توهان وٽ ٽيبل آهي جنهن ۾ ان ۾ هڪ ٻي ٽيبل تيار ڪيو وڃي. جڏهن ته اهو ٿي سگهي ٿو، اڪثر ڪري توهان نائينبل ٽيبل کي ٿورو وڌيڪ پيچيده ميزائين ۾ استعمال ڪري سگهو ٿا ۽ توهان جي ٽيبل سيل تي خاص ڪري سگهو ٿا. مثال طور، ناست ٿيل جدول ۾ مٿينء ۾، مان هن کي هڪ واحد ٽيبل ۾ صرف کولسپان خاصيت سان تبديل ڪري سگهان ٿو.

<ٽيبل>

ڪالم 1
colspan = "2" > ڪالمن 2
ڪالمن 3


کالم 1
ناھر ٿيل ٽيبل ڪالمن 1
ناھر ٿيل ٽيبل ڪالمن 2
کالم 3


کالم 1
colspan = "2" > کالم 2
کالم 3

هن ٽيبل تي نيلز ميز جي ڀيٽ ۾ گهٽ حرفن جي استعمال جو فائدو پڻ آهي، انهي ڪري اهو انهي سان گڏ ڊائون لوڊ ڪري سگهندو.